Using Double Wires as a Stability Solution
Örebro University, School of Medical Sciences. Örebro University Hospital. Department of Cardiothoracic and Vascular Surgery; Department of Surgery.ORCID iD: 0000-0003-3912-4732
Örebro University, School of Medical Sciences. Department of Cardiothoracic and Vascular Surgery.ORCID iD: 0000-0003-0805-4823
2023 (English)In: Journal of Endovascular Resuscitation and Trauma Management (JEVTM), ISSN 2002-7567, Vol. 7, no 1, p. 45-45Article in journal, Editorial material (Other academic) Published
Abstract [en]

At times, when the endovascular delivery or catheter system is unstable, two wires can be used, forming a double wire system.
